Adams County Continues Investigation Into Triple Homicide

ADAMS COUNTY, Colo. (CBS4) - Investigators of a triple homicide in Adams County spent a second day Thursday searching for clues near the scene of the murders.

Detectives filled bags with evidence, as a K-9 unit trained to search for drugs worked the scene.

Police are seeking Furmen Lee Leyba, 31, in the deaths. Gabriel Flores has been arrested.

The bodies of three men were found early Wednesday morning in a home near Broadway and Cragmore, just northeast of the Interstate 25 and Boulder turnpike interchange. Deputies arrived after receiving a call about a disturbance.

The victims' names haven't been released.

"It's a shock," Tracy Sitterud said. "It's something that you hear that this happens all the time but you don't expect it on your street, right down the street from your house. And especially in a very quiet neighborhood where people wave at each other as you drive by. It's nerve-racking."

So far, the Adams County Sheriff's Office is not saying what may have been the motive in this case.

After a chase in Jefferson County, deputies arrested Flores, 41. He remains in the Adams County Jail, without bond, and faces first-degree murder charges.

A woman was also in Flores' car, but the sheriff's office didn't call her a suspect.
